Grandson Gone Missing for 114 Days After Saying 'Going Out with Friends', Grandmother in Changhua Selling Porridge Searches in Despair, Police Discovered He Went to Thailand on March 4th

Reported 11 months ago

In Changhua County, a 75-year-old grandmother supported her grandson by selling porridge, but he went missing in March after telling his grandmother he was going out with friends. It was later found by police that he had left for Thailand on March 4th. The 20-year-old man has been missing for 114 days. The grandmother participated in a press conference with a signboard showing her grandson's photo and 'Are you still there?' written on it. The case has been reported to the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, and the Criminal Investigation Bureau is assisting the family in the investigation.
